Virtual Business Challenge
What is it?
Virtual Business Challenge, or VBC for short, was designed by, Knowledge Matters. Its goal is to allow students all over the country to demonstrate and learn new skills through extensive simulations. FBLA is participating in the following Simulations:
Virtual Business Challenge Finance (VBCF) - In this simulation, you and your team will work together to decide what their character will do to accumulate the most money in the allotted time period. This simulation has many aspects of real life such as the ability to get a job, maintaining a schedule, and even use a credit card. The simulation goes further into depth by giving you a credit score, a resume, and a net worth while also allowing you to set your own schedule, apply for a job, get a degree, buy your own furniture, apply for loans, buy your own food, file tax returns, buy insurance, pay for internet, use debit cards, open checking accounts and saving accounts, and more.
Qualifying - In order to move on to the next round, you and your team must come in second place or higher in your region.
Virtual Business Challenge (Management) (VBCM) - In this simulation, you and your team will work together to make decisions to get the most profit for your jeans factory in the allotted time period. This simulation has many aspects of real life such as the ability to hire and fire people, decide production rates, and supervise workers. The simulation goes further into depth by allowing you to set the number of breaks your workers get in a day, set wages, and even allow for your workers to go on strike and/or sue your company if conditions are poor.
Qualifying - In order to move on to the next round, you and your team must come in second place or higher in your region.
